> The Mahout examples try to create directories (such as work) under
> /usr/lib/mahout/examples/bin, which won't work if the user running the
> examples doesn't have write access to that directory. Preferably, the
> examples would be using something like /tmp/mahout-work-${user}, so that the
> directory can be created/written to/deleted by the current user. This will
> need to be fixed upstream.
